This private pasta-making class in Bari, Italy provides a hands-on, half-day experience focused on traditional dishes from the Puglia region.

Guests will learn to make fresh pasta from scratch, including local favorites like orecchiette. They’ll also get to taste everything prepared, accompanied by local wines.

The class covers a sample menu of dishes like cavatelli, fogliette dulivo, and ravioli. Beverages including water, wines, and coffee are provided throughout the session.

The experience ends back at the original meeting point in Bari.

Tasting the Local Flavors of Puglia

Participants in the private pasta class savor the authentic flavors of Puglia as they indulge in the homemade dishes.

The menu features a tantalizing selection of local specialties, including:

  • Orecchiette, the signature pasta shape of the region, with its distinctive "little ears" texture.

  • Cavatelli, handmade from semolina dough, paired with savory sauces.

  • Fogliette dulivo, a unique pasta shape made with olive oil.

  • Ravioli, filled with fresh, seasonal ingredients to capture the essence of Puglia’s bountiful produce.

The pasta-making class becomes a culinary journey, allowing participants to enjoy the rich gastronomic heritage of this southern Italian region.
